§ 17-27-313 — Criminal background checks

Arkansas·Title 17
(a)The Arkansas Board of Examiners in Counseling may require each applicant for license renewal and each first-time applicant for a license issued by the board to apply to the Identification Bureau of the Division of Arkansas State Police for a state and national criminal background check, to be conducted by the Identification Bureau of the Division of Arkansas State Police and the Federal Bureau of Investigation.
(b)The check shall conform to the applicable federal standards and shall include the taking of fingerprints.
(c)The applicant shall sign a release of information to the board and shall be responsible for the payment of any fee associated with the criminal background check.
